Foggy conditions for quite a few this morning and is becoming dense in spots. This may cause a few 2-hr delays and slow commutes into work. As the sun comes up this morning, we’ll see improving visibility with skies becoming mostly to partly sunny. Highs finally warm up to the upper 70s but starts to cool right back down tomorrow. Most of tomorrow is dry with just an isolated chance for a shower. Sunshine continues through much of the weekend with highs warming back into the low 80s.
Today: AM Fog then mostly to partly sunny, high of 78.
Tonight: Mostly clear, low 60.
Thursday: Partly cloudy, isolated shower possible, high of 74.
Friday: Sunny, highs in the low 70s.
